c# ResXResourceSet在官方示例之后没有得到解决
本文关键字:解决 之后 ResXResourceSet 官方 | 更新日期: 2023-09-27 18:04:03
根据官方文档和示例,在System.Resources
命名空间中应该存在ResXResourceSet
类。
//从.resx文件中获取资源
using (ResXResourceSet resxSet = new ResXResourceSet(resxFile))
{…
但是,它不能在我的。net 4.5控制台应用程序中解决:
using (var resx = new System.Resources.ResXResourceSet(path))
...
项目文件行抑制状态命名空间"System"中不存在类型或命名空间"ResXResourceSet"。"资源"(是否缺少程序集引用?)
我错过了什么吗?示例教程没有提到任何必需的程序集,并且可以找到System.Resources
名称空间本身,并包含一个具有类似名称的类- ResourceSet
,然而,似乎只使用二进制文件。
此类的MSDN页面声明所需的程序集是System.Windows.Forms。在相应的页面
上,为每个。net类声明此信息。您提供的链接只是对所提到的几个类如何工作的总体描述。但是在一般情况下,描述中的每个类可能在不同的命名空间或不同的程序集中,因此有关这些的信息总是在类的主页上为每个类单独编写的。